The Cromwell Cardinals can now show off eight landslide victories after their most recent matchup on Tuesday. They blew past Two Harbors 61-23 at home. Given Cromwell's advantage in MaxPreps' Minnesota basketball rankings (they are ranked 88th, while the Agates are ranked 340th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
Isabella Anderson was her usual excellent self, scoring 11 points along with six rebounds and five steals. She has been hot recently, having posted two or more steals the last seven times she's played. Another player making a difference was Siiena Anderson, who scored eight points along with three steals.
Cromwell is on a roll lately: they've won four of their last five matches, which provided a nice bump to their 14-6 record this season. As for Two Harbors, they are on a four-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 4-16.
